問題タブ [devtools]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
4057 参照

windows - erlang.el で Erlang + Emacs をセットアップするには?

Erlang とEmacsW32をダウンロードしてインストールしました。erlang.elしかし、Emacs ではどのように使用すればよいのでしょうか? どこに配置またはインストールしますか?

Erlang/OTP R13B04 のドキュメントEmacs の Erlang モードのドキュメントを読みましたが、設定方法に関する情報が見つかりませんでした。

更新 1: Emacs の Erlang モードに関するドキュメントをさらに見つけました。にスクリプトを入力しましたが、.emacsEmacsFile error: Cannot open load file, erlang-startを起動するとエラーが発生するため、何か問題があります。

更新 2:これが私の.emacs見た目です。上記のリンクから直接取得されます。

更新 3:別のコンピューター、Windows 7、GNU Emacs 23.1.50.1 で試してみました。.emacsファイルは次の場所にありますC:\Users\Jonas\.emacs.d\.emacs

M-x erlang-versionEmacs で入力しようとすると、次のメッセージが表示されます。[No match]

0 投票する
4 に答える
115 参照

language-agnostic - プレリリース開発ツールを使用した開発

私たちはウェブサイトを開発しています。私たちが使用している開発ツールの 1 つは、次のバージョンのアルファ リリースを利用できます。これには、私たちが実際に使用したい多くの機能が含まれています (つまり、ほとんど正確に実行するために何千行も実装する必要がなくなります)。とにかく同じこと)。

私はそれについていくつかの初期評価を行いましたが、私が見たものは気に入っています。問題は、実際にそれを実際に使い始めるべきかということです。つまり、それを評価するだけでなく、実際に開発に使用し、依存していますか?

アルファ版ソフトウェアなので、明らかにまだリリースの準備ができていません...しかし、私たち自身のコードもそうではありません。これはオープン ソースであり、デバッグに必要なスキルがあるため、理論上は実際にバグ修正を提供することができます。

しかしその一方で、それのリリース スケジュールがどのようなものかはわかりません (彼らはまだ公開していません)。それを使用して開発することは問題ないと思いますが、本番環境で使用することについては確信が持てないので、私たちの準備が整う前に準備ができていなければ、私たち自身の打ち上げが遅れる可能性があります.

どう思いますか?リスクを取る価値はありますか?同様の状況の経験はありますか (良いか悪いかを問わず)?

[編集] 質問の範囲を広く保つために、使用している言語や問題の開発ツールを意図的に指定していません。これは、ほぼすべての開発環境に適用できる質問だと思うからです。

[EDIT2] 非常に役立つ返信をしてくれた Marjan に感謝します。もっと多くの反応を期待していたので、これに賞金をかけます。

0 投票する
1 に答える
1155 参照

linux - ナイトリー ビルドの最後のステップとして Intellij IDEA のインデックス作成を開始できますか?

毎晩のビルド中に、最新のコミットされたチェックインをマルチサイト ソース管理リポジトリから取得し、ローカル ソースの変更をマージしてコンパイル/ビルドします。これにより、多くのファイルの日付と内容が変更されたままになります。翌朝到着して Intellij IDEA ウィンドウをクリックすると、IDEA はソース ファイルのインデックスを再構築します。Intellij IDEA 10 では、これがバックグラウンドで行われ、速度が大幅に向上するはずです。待っている間、ソースに対して多くの (すべてではない) 操作を実行できます。

バックグラウンドでインデックス作成を行うのは素晴らしいことですが、毎晩のビルドの最後のステップとして、コマンドを実行して Intellij IDEA にファイルのインデックスを再作成させることはできますか? そうすれば、オフィスに着く前にインデックスの再作成が完了し、準備が整います。

IDEA を強制終了して再起動するとうまくいくと思いますが、少し厳しいようです。その時点で編集内容が保存されていないことを確認したいと思います。参考までに、Debian Linux で実行しています。

ありがとう、アラン

0 投票する
2 に答える
7165 参照

javascript - console.log のリスニング

デフォルトの動作を妨げずに、メッセージのリスナーを設定しconsole.log()て何かをしたいと考えています。そのため、開発ツールのコンソールにもメッセージが表示されるはずです。何か案は?

0 投票する
2 に答える
320 参照

bash - devtoolsパッケージのbashは何をしますか?

前の質問に答えて、sed、rsync、sshなどを呼び出すためのRのsystem()の代替:関数は存在しますか、自分で書く必要がありますか、それとも要点を見逃していますか?ハドリーの 答えは、同様の問題に直面したとき、彼は次のような関数を使用したことを示していました。

私は彼のdevtoolsパッケージでオリジナルを見つけました。devtools / R / bash.Rに実装されています

この点がわかりません。私が発行するとき

それは私をbashシェルに送り、その後exit私をRセッションに戻しますが、機能はありませんbash。次のコマンドペア(Rの最初のコマンド、bashの2番目のコマンド)のいずれかを発行することで、同じ効果を得ることができるようです。

また

打たれた部分は私の部分のコピー/貼り付けエラーが原因でした

bashまた、devtoolsパッケージで関数のそれ以上の使用法を見つけることができません

bash誰かが関数の使い方を理解するのを手伝ってくれませんか。インタラクティブRモード以外のコンテキスト(スクリプトや関数内など)で使用できますか?

0 投票する
1 に答える
161 参照

xcode - 最後の Xcode 4.2.1 はすべての devtools パッケージをインストールしません

大きな問題があります。私のマッキントッシュ HD は死んでいました。それで、すべてのデータをフォーマットしました。すごい !:(

Mac AppStore で xcode をダウンロードしてインストールしましたが、いくつかのエラーがあります。どうやら、すべての開発ツールがインストールされていません。

Doxygen がインストールされていない、GCC4.2 がインストールされていない、...

devtools パッケージはありますか?

一番。

0 投票する
3 に答える
913 参照

r - Rのdevtools-「configure」ファイルを使用してgithubからインストールします

「configure」スクリプトを使用するRパッケージがgithubにあります(Cコードの一部はGSLライブラリに依存しているため)。devtoolsパッケージからgithub_install()関数を使用してパッケージをインストールしようとすると、エラーが発生します。

何をすべきかわからない-github上のファイルの実行権限などはありますか?これはdevtoolsの問題ですか、それとも構成の問題ですか?(ソースからパッケージをインストールすることは私にとってはうまくいきます)。パッケージはこちらです。 https://github.com/cboettig/wrightscape

0 投票する
1 に答える
636 参照

r - 同じパッケージでシミュレートの s3 および s4 メソッドを使用する R

エラーで困っています

S3 メソッドとして、simulate() メソッドの定義を含む R パッケージを作成しました。シミュレートのジェネリックは既に定義されているため、 simulate.myclass (私の場合は simulate.fitContinuous) を定義するだけです。

このパッケージは、シミュレートの S4 バージョンを含む別のパッケージにも依存しています。パッケージをロードすると、上記の S4 バージョン エラーが発生します。何がエラーを生成しているのかわかりません。

github からパッケージを取得するか、実行することによる再現可能な例


このエラーを最初から再現するには: 最小限の DESCRIPTION ファイルで新しいパッケージを作成します。説明のインポートを含めます: 痛い。NAMESPACE を作成し、imports(ouch) と S3method(simulate, test) を追加します。R ディレクトリを作成し、簡単な R スクリプトを追加します (前述の名前空間を生成する roxygen のドキュメントを含めましたが、このエラーは devtools/roxygen がなくても作成される可能性があります)。

パッケージをインストールすると (必要に応じて最初に devtools をドキュメント化してください)、エラーが発生します。

これまでの私の最善の解決策は、NAMESPACE から S3method 行を削除し、代わりに完全な関数の simulate.test をエクスポートすることです。これは警告なしでチェックとインストールに合格しますが、明らかに劣ったソリューションです。

別の解決策は、インポートと同様に依存関係を持ち、S3 メソッドを適切に文書化することです (上記のように)。その後、すべてが期待どおりに機能しますが、警告メッセージは残ります。

0 投票する
2 に答える
5727 参照

r - testthat テストまたは run_examples() で R パッケージ データを使用することは可能ですか?

devtools、testthat、および roxygen2 を使用して、R パッケージの開発に取り組んでいます。データ フォルダー (foo.txt と bar.csv) にいくつかのデータ セットがあります。

私のファイル構造は次のようになります。

「foo」と「bar」が正しく文書化されていると確信しています:

ドキュメントの例と単体テストで「foo」と「bar」のデータを使用したいと思います。

たとえば、次を呼び出してテストするテストでこれらのデータセットを使用したいと思います。

そして、ドキュメントの例を次のようにしたいと思います。

パッケージの開発中に data(foo) を呼び出そうとすると、「data set 'foo' not found」というエラーが発生します。ただし、パッケージをビルドしてインストールし、ロードすると、テストとサンプルを機能させることができます。

私の現在の回避策は、例を実行しないことです。

テストでは、ローカル コンピューターに固有のパスを使用してデータを事前に読み込みます。

これは理想的とは思えません。特に私は他のユーザーと共同作業を行っているため、すべての共同作業者が 'foo' と 'bar' への同じフル パスを持っている必要があります。さらに、ドキュメントの例は実行できないように見えますが、パッケージをインストールすると実行できます。

助言がありますか?どうもありがとう。

0 投票する
1 に答える
1802 参照

r - install_github がエラーを返す: zip ファイルを開けません

次を実行すると:

次のエラーが表示されます。

devtools 0.51 の場合:

より新しいバージョン (0.6) の devtools をインストールしました。install_github('devtools')

エラーはより有益ですが、似ています:

私は何か間違ったことをしていますか?